bacardi23 23 Oct 2010 05:01

Found the problem!

The XT600E stock computer/display/manometer has several small bulbs.

One of the bulbs is the Turn signals warning light.

On the XT that warning light has TWO POSITIVES connect to it!
And , with my knowledge, the only way that bulb can work is if internally, on the bulb socket there is a ground!

On the Trailtech Vapor indicator dashboard, with the same scheme it doesn't work and makes the 4 turn signals blink at the same time!

wolfzero 24 Oct 2010 16:05

the wattage of the trailtech bulb is irrelavant you are blocking the reverse voltage across all the indicators if your using standard bulbs not LED's then you will in theory need a 3amp diode but if you can't get a couple of those 1amp should be fine as the indicators flash so the load is not constant.

wolfzero 24 Oct 2010 16:55

led's dont draw much current so that's why all your indicators flash you will need to earth one side of the trailtech bulb and use the two diode set up you posted erlia so 1/4 watt diodes would be fine due to the low current draw of the led's
